Run flats refer to an insert in the tire that allows them to run with no air in them. Run flats are basically a big piece of rubber  (looks like a doughnut) placed inside the tire on the rim and only lets the tires go down a certain amount (about 30% or the normal ride height) They are ONLY usable at low speed and limited distance. Using then for even short distances will wreck the tire but it can get you out of a jam if you are being shot at. If you insert the runflats you also have to put in a few tubes of a grease compound that prevent the tire from catching on fire when the run flat is in use.



In general run flats have a bad reputation for the hummer H1's. They make the tire very hard to service and they are a problem when trying to keep the tire balanced. Many people leave them out after they do the tire change IF THEY CAN. Some of the H1 wheels require bead locks and the the run flat is part of this system (on some wheels). I have bead locks on one truck, run flats on the other  (H1's) and regular tires on the H2.  The stock H2 tires/rim are the best ride of the bunch (even with H2 rims/bigger BFG on the H1.)



All this being said, there are civilian sport tires that are run flat but these are for sports cars from what I recall (Pirelli's from what I remember).
